Why are customers willing to pay extra for 24-hour delivery, yet abandon their carts if the shipping time exceeds a few days? In an era of instant payments, high-speed internet, and lightning-fast online shopping, consumer patience has all but disappeared. Fast delivery today is not just a convenience – it’s a real factor affecting sales, loyalty, and competitive advantage. The psychology of expectation shows that the faster you satisfy a customer’s need, the more likely they are to return. In this article, we explore why fast delivery is no longer a luxury but a standard and what data confirms this.
